<dfn id="w48us"></dfn><ul id="w48us"></ul>
  • <ul id="w48us"></ul>
  • <del id="w48us"></del>
    <ul id="w48us"></ul>
  • 詳解JavaScript中的splice()使用方法

    時間:2024-08-20 12:22:33 JavaScript 我要投稿
    • 相關推薦

    詳解JavaScript中的splice()使用方法

      定義和用法

      splice() 方法用于插入、刪除或替換數(shù)組的元素。

      語法

      arrayObject.splice(index,howmany,element1,.....,elementX)

      參數(shù) 描述

      index 必需。規(guī)定從何處添加/刪除元素。

      該參數(shù)是開始插入和(或)刪除的數(shù)組元素的下標,必須是數(shù)字。

      howmany 必需。規(guī)定應該刪除多少元素。必須是數(shù)字,但可以是 "0"。

      如果未規(guī)定此參數(shù),則刪除從 index 開始到原數(shù)組結尾的所有元素。

      element1 可選。規(guī)定要添加到數(shù)組的新元素。從 index 所指的下標處開始插入。

      elementX 可選。可向數(shù)組添加若干元素。

      返回值

      如果從 arrayObject 中刪除了元素,則返回的是含有被刪除的元素的數(shù)組。

      說明

      splice() 方法可刪除從 index 處開始的零個或多個元素,并且用參數(shù)列表中聲明的一個或多個值來替換那些被刪除的元素。

      提示和注釋

      注釋:請注意,splice() 方法與 slice() 方法的作用是不同的,splice() 方法會直接對數(shù)組進行修改。

      實例

      例子 1

      在本例中,我們將創(chuàng)建一個新數(shù)組,并向其添加一個元素:

      復制代碼 代碼如下:

      var arr = new Array(6) arr[0] = "George" arr[1] = "John" arr[2] = "Thomas" arr[3] = "James" arr[4] = "Adrew" arr[5] = "Martin" document.write(arr + "") arr.splice(2,0,"William") document.write(arr + "")

      輸出:

      George,John,Thomas,James,Adrew,Martin George,John,William,Thomas,James,Adrew,Martin

      例子 2

      在本例中我們將刪除位于 index 2 的元素,并添加一個新元素來替代被刪除的元素:

      復制代碼 代碼如下:

      var arr = new Array(6) arr[0] = "George" arr[1] = "John" arr[2] = "Thomas" arr[3] = "James" arr[4] = "Adrew" arr[5] = "Martin" document.write(arr + "") arr.splice(2,1,"William") document.write(arr)

      輸出:

      George,John,Thomas,James,Adrew,Martin George,John,William,James,Adrew,Martin

      例子 3

      在本例中我們將刪除從 index 2 ("Thomas") 開始的三個元素,并添加一個新元素 ("William") 來替代被刪除的元素:

      復制代碼 代碼如下:

      var arr = new Array(6) arr[0] = "George" arr[1] = "John" arr[2] = "Thomas" arr[3] = "James" arr[4] = "Adrew" arr[5] = "Martin" document.write(arr + "") arr.splice(2,3,"William") document.write(arr)

      輸出:

      George,John,Thomas,James,Adrew,Martin George,John,William,Martin

    【詳解JavaScript中的splice()使用方法】相關文章:

    Javascript中arguments對象的詳解和使用方法03-31

    JavaScript中push(),join() 函數(shù)實例詳解03-31

    在Java中執(zhí)行JavaScript代碼04-01

    Javascript中typeof 用法歸納04-01

    JavaScript中的with關鍵字03-25

    perl- javascript中class的機制03-25

    JavaScript中的三種對象04-01

    抽象語法樹在JavaScript中的應用03-25

    關于javascript對象之內(nèi)置和對象Math的使用方法03-30

    主站蜘蛛池模板: 国产精品一级片| 国产成人AV无码精品| 亚洲精品理论电影在线观看| 亚洲av永久无码精品国产精品| 亚洲天堂久久精品| 久久国产精品99精品国产| 久久精品国产亚洲精品| 免费精品一区二区三区第35| 久久综合精品国产二区无码| 欧美午夜精品一区二区三区91 | 亚洲欧美日韩久久精品| 国产精品美女久久久久av爽 | 美女岳肉太深了使劲国产精品亚洲专一区二区三区 | 亚洲国产精品热久久| 成人区人妻精品一区二区不卡网站| 亚洲午夜精品一级在线播放放| 狠狠色伊人久久精品综合网| 66精品综合久久久久久久| 99精品免费视品| 国产网红无码精品视频| 无码人妻精品中文字幕免费| 亚洲精品国产精品国自产观看| 久久99热这里只有精品国产| 国产精品偷窥熟女精品视频| 亚洲精品一二区| 久久国产精品-国产精品| 国产精品伦一区二区三级视频| 老司机亚洲精品影院无码| 亚洲日韩精品无码专区网站| 久久精品国产精品亚洲艾草网美妙| 国产精品丝袜久久久久久不卡| 国产精品无码DVD在线观看| 91精品日韩人妻无码久久不卡 | 国产成人精品精品欧美| 国语自产精品视频在线区| 久久99精品久久久久久久不卡| 久久精品国产精品亚洲毛片| 精品亚洲aⅴ在线观看| 久久精品国产清高在天天线| 精品人妻系列无码天堂 | 四虎国产精品永免费|